"use strict";
Object.defineProperty(exports, "__esModule", { value: true });
exports.Y4MHeader = exports.Y4MFrame = exports.Y4MFrameHeader = void 0;
const frame_1 = require("./frame");
function interlacingFromChar(char) {
switch (char) {
case 't':
return 'TopFieldFirst';
case 'b':
return 'BottomFieldFirst';
case 'm':
return 'Mixed';
case 'p':
default:
return 'Progressive';
}
}
class Y4MFrameHeader {
}
exports.Y4MFrameHeader = Y4MFrameHeader;
class Y4MFrame {
constructor(fn, yuv) {
this.fn = fn;
this.yuv = yuv;
}
}
exports.Y4MFrame = Y4MFrame;
class Y4MHeader {
constructor() {
this.interlacing = 'Progressive';
this.aspectRatio = { numerator: 1, denominator: 1 };
this.colorspace = 'C420mpeg2';
this.timeScale = -1;
}
chromaWidth() {
if (this.colorspace == 'C444' || this.colorspace == 'C422') {
return this.width;
}
else {
return Math.ceil(this.width / 2);
}
}
chromaHeight() {
if (this.colorspace == 'C444') {
return this.height;
}
else {
return Math.ceil(this.height / 2);
}
}
chromaSize() {
return this.chromaWidth() * this.chromaHeight();
}
lumaSize() {
return this.width * this.height;
}
getFrameSize() {
return this.lumaSize() + this.chromaSize() * 2;
}
static fromString(line) {
if ('YUV4MPEG2 ' != line.substring(0, 10)) {
throw new Error('Wrong yuv4mpeg header.');
}
const split = line.substring(10).split(' ');
const header = new Y4MHeader();
for (const s of split) {
const key = s.charAt(0);
const value = s.substring(1);
switch (key) {
case 'W':
header.width = parseInt(value);
break;
case 'H':
header.height = parseInt(value);
break;
case 'F':
header.frameRate = (0, frame_1.parseRational)(value);
header.timeScale = header.frameRate.numerator;
header.videoMediaTimeScale = header.timeScale;
break;
case 'I':
header.interlacing = interlacingFromChar(s.charAt(1));
break;
case 'A':
header.aspectRatio = (0, frame_1.parseRational)(value);
break;
case 'C':
header.colorspace = s;
break;
case 'X':
header.comment = value;
const vmtsMatch = Y4MHeader.videoMediaTimeScaleRegex.exec(line);
if (vmtsMatch != null) {
header.videoMediaTimeScale = parseInt(vmtsMatch.groups.ts);
}
else {
const tsMatch = Y4MHeader.timeScaleRegex.exec(line);
if (tsMatch != null) {
header.timeScale = parseInt(tsMatch.groups.ts);
}
}
break;
}
}
return header;
}
toString() {
return `YUV4MPEG2 W${this.width} H${this.height} F${this.frameRate.numerator}:${this.frameRate.denominator} Ip A${this.aspectRatio.numerator}:${this.aspectRatio.denominator} ${this.colorspace} XYSCSS=420MPEG2`;
}
}
exports.Y4MHeader = Y4MHeader;
Y4MHeader.timeScaleRegex = /TS=(?<ts>\d+)/;
Y4MHeader.videoMediaTimeScaleRegex = /VMTS=(?<ts>\d+)/;
